What is Penn Health Group?

Penn Health Group is a medical cannabis company based in Pennsylvania. They are focused on cultivating, processing, and distributing medical marijuana products to patients with qualifying medical conditions. As a licensed medical marijuana organization, Penn Health Group operates in compliance with state regulations to ensure patients have access to safe and effective products. Their operations include growing cannabis plants, extracting cannabinoids, and formulating products such as oils, tinctures, and capsules. The company is committed to supporting patient wellness and advancing medical cannabis research.

Penn State Health is seeking a fellowship trained Diagnostic Radiologist to join our existing Medical Group practice located in Central Pennsylvania.

The ideal candidate would not only be proficient in their subspecialty, but all General Radiology Modalities (including mammography). The ability to perform breast biopsies and minor procedures such as Paracentesis, LP, and Thoracentesis are welcome, however are not required. The candidate will be provided with appropriate training/supervision and the opportunity to become proficient in mammography and the procedures listed above, if needed.

This is an excellent opportunity for any subspecialty trained radiologist (Body Imaging, Neuroradiology, MSK, etc.) who wants to maintain broad skill sets while also practicing in their specialty as part of a growing, innovative, integrated academic and community practice radiology network.

About Penn State Health

Sourced by ZipRecruiter

Penn State Health is one of the leading teaching and research hospitals in the country. It is a multi-hospital health system, Academic Medical Center and Level 1 adult and pediatric trauma center serving patients and communities across Central Pennsylvania. The system includes Penn State Health Milton S. Hershey Medical Center, Penn State Children's Hospital, and Penn State Cancer Institute in scenic Hershey, PA. It also includes Penn State Health Saint Joseph's Medical Center in Reading, PA, Penn State Health Holy Spirit Medical Center in Camp Hill, PA, and Penn State Health Hampden Medical Center in Enola, PA. Penn State Health shares an integrated strategic plan and operations with Penn State College of Medicine.
